Sean’s 100% Handmade Chair
A few months back, I discovered a blog, Knock Off Wood, while stumbling on StumbleUpon and fell in love. In short, it’s a blog that belongs to this housewife in Alaska that loves designer furniture, but not designer prices, much like myself. So she finds pieces of furniture she likes and makes them herself.
I’m all about saving money and still getting what I want. And, my dad loves to build things out of wood and has everything needed to do it. I printed out some of the plans of things I’d like for him to make for me and his first project was this Land of Nod inspired chair with storage underneath it, with mild changes/alterations. It turned out great! I absolutely love it! I painted it with some of the remaining paint from painting Sean’s bedroom. I plan to have him make two more — one that I will paint lime green and another I will paint black and put “time out” with a clock painted on it on the seat for future time out sessions (not that he’s ever done anything that would require it, but he is getting older, so it’s inevitable).
